Beyond Visual Inspection: The Need for Advanced ID Scanning Solutions

In today's world, security and verification are paramount. Traditional methods of confirming individuals often rely on visual inspection of identification, which can be vulnerable to fraud and inaccuracies. To address this increasing challenge, advanced ID scanning solutions are becoming indispensable. These systems utilize sophisticated technologies, such as optical character recognition (OCR) and biometric analysis, to precisely analyze ID documents and authenticate the identity presented. By eliminating the risk of human bias, advanced ID scanning solutions provide a more trustworthy means of confirming individuals in a variety of settings.

The benefits of these solutions are extensive. They can strengthen security measures, prevent identity theft, and streamline procedures.

For instance, in financial institutions, advanced ID scanning can authenticate customer identities during account opening or transaction processing. Similarly, in government agencies, these systems can be used to provide documents with greater reliability.
